Common Types

The types defined in this section are fairly simple and used in many of the more complex data types.

Time


        Time ::=
              ( seconds         :       INT32;
                minutes         :       INT32;
                hours           :       INT32;
                day             :       INT32;
                month           :       INT32;
                year            :       INT32;
                day-of-week     :       INT32;
                day-of-year     :       INT32;
                is-dst          :       BOOL;
              )

Time is used to specify times in several data structures. The fields seconds, minutes and hours give wall clock time. day is the day of month and month is the current month, starting with zero for January. year is the number of years since 1900. day-of-week is the current weekday, with zero used for Sunday. day-of-year is how many days of the year have passed starting with zero and is-dst is true when the time indicated is daylight savings time.

When the server receives a Time structure from a client it ignores the day-of-week and day-of-year fields.

All times are expressed in the time zone of the server, unless the set-connection-time-format request is used.

Conference Numbers


        Conf-No         ::=     INT16;

This type denotes a conference number.

Text Numbers


        Text-No         ::=     INT32;
        Local-Text-No   ::=     INT32;
        Text-List       ::=
              ( first-local-no  :       Local-Text-No;
                texts           :       ARRAY Text-No;
              )

These three types are used to indicate articles in the LysKOM database. Text-No is a global text number and Local-Text-No a local text number. Text-List is used when a mapping from local to global numbers are required.

Person and Session Numbers


        Pers-No         ::=     Conf-No;
        Session-No      ::=     INT32;

Pers-No is used to indicate a person. Session-No is used in a few data structures relating to information about active LysKOM sessions.
